#316e23 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#316e23 is composed of 19.2% red, 43.1% green and 13.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 68.2% yellow and 56.9% black. It has a hue angle of 108.8 degrees, a saturation of 51.7% and a lightness of 28.4%. #316e23 color hex could be obtained by blending #62dc46 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

Shades and Tints of #316e23

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030602 is the darkest color, while #f7fcf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#316e23

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#464d44 is the less saturated color, while #1c8f02 is the most saturated one.
